The Multifunction Vehicle Bus (MVB) is a critical component in railway and transportation systems, responsible for the reliable communication between various subsystems within a vehicle. This standard, IEC 61375-2-6, provides detailed specifications for testing MVB communication systems to ensure they meet stringent performance requirements.

Compliance with this international standard is essential for manufacturers and suppliers of railway equipment aiming to ensure robust and reliable communications within their products. The tests outlined in the standard are designed to verify that all components connected to the MVB function correctly under various operating conditions, including temperature variations, electrical noise, and signal integrity.
